James Moger
2013-10-24 90d5e02cca934cdf8d582873f5bf13e710c12393
src/main/java/com/gitblit/wicket/pages/MarkdownPage.java
@@ -16,7 +16,6 @@
package com.gitblit.wicket.pages;
import java.text.MessageFormat;
import java.text.ParseException;
import org.apache.wicket.PageParameters;
import org.apache.wicket.markup.html.basic.Label;
@@ -29,8 +28,11 @@
import com.gitblit.utils.JGitUtils;
import com.gitblit.utils.MarkdownUtils;
import com.gitblit.utils.StringUtils;
import com.gitblit.wicket.CacheControl;
import com.gitblit.wicket.CacheControl.LastModified;
import com.gitblit.wicket.WicketUtils;
@CacheControl(LastModified.BOOT)
public class MarkdownPage extends RepositoryPage {
   public MarkdownPage(PageParameters params) {
@@ -41,7 +43,7 @@
      Repository r = getRepository();
      RevCommit commit = JGitUtils.getCommit(r, objectId);
      String [] encodings = GitBlit.getEncodings();
      // markdown page links
      add(new BookmarkablePageLink<Void>("blameLink", BlamePage.class,
            WicketUtils.newPathParameter(repositoryName, objectId, markdownPath)));
@@ -57,7 +59,8 @@
      String htmlText;
      try {
         htmlText = MarkdownUtils.transformMarkdown(markdownText);
      } catch (ParseException p) {
      } catch (Exception e) {
         logger.error("failed to transform markdown", e);
         markdownText = MessageFormat.format("<div class=\"alert alert-error\"><strong>{0}:</strong> {1}</div>{2}", getString("gb.error"), getString("gb.markdownFailure"), markdownText);
         htmlText = StringUtils.breakLinesForHtml(markdownText);
      }
@@ -70,7 +73,7 @@
   protected String getPageName() {
      return getString("gb.markdown");
   }
   @Override
   protected Class<? extends BasePage> getRepoNavPageClass() {
      return DocsPage.class;